How they compare
Europe (UNSDG) currently reports 3,890 against 718 in Peru, a difference of 3,172.
That makes Europe (UNSDG)'s figure about 5.4 times Peru's.
Across all 35 years both countries report, Europe (UNSDG) has been ahead every year.
Europe (UNSDG) ranks 59th and Peru ranks 62nd of 68 groups.
Europe (UNSDG) has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Europe (UNSDG) | Peru |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 15,508 | 2,363 | 13,145 | Europe (UNSDG) |
| 2000s | 7,596 | 1,149 | 6,446 | Europe (UNSDG) |
| 2010s | 4,968 | 811.1 | 4,157 | Europe (UNSDG) |
| 2020s | 4,150 | 755.2 | 3,394 | Europe (UNSDG) |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
